Gold Suckers or gravel pumps are very effective for cleaning bedrock under water. They are excellent where you can't use motorized equipment such as dredges or dredge attachments on high bankers.

Classifiers are used to screen or classify material before panning or sluicing. With any gravity separation method, the closer in size the material is, the more efficient the operation will be.

Black sand separators When you have a lot of concentrates from a sluice box, highbanker etc, you will find it is very tedious to pan out the fine gold from the black sand. These mini-sluices will get most of the black sand out without losing the fine gold.

Rocker Box This rocker box plan is reprinted from Information Circular 6786, "Placer Mining in the Western United States". It was published by the US Bureau of Mines in September, 1934.
